Master the MEAN Stack - Learn By Example

Why take this course?
🚀 Master the MEAN Stack - Learn By Example 🎓
Headline: Dive Deep into Full Stack JavaScript Development with AngularJS, Node.js, Express and MongoDB!
Course Description:
Please note: This course is designed for individuals who already have a grasp of the basics of Node.js and AngularJS 1.x. If you're new to these technologies, we recommend starting with introductory courses first.
Embark on a journey to master one of the most powerful and versatile tech stacks out there: the MEAN stack! This course is a practical, hands-on guide to building a full stack web application from scratch using Node.js, AngularJS, Express.js, and MongoDB.
Course Overview:
We'll kick off our project by setting up a sophisticated authorization system, and then we'll dive deep into coding a fully-featured web application named "Best Dressed". This app will be a showcase of various functionalities that are common in real-world applications, including upload capabilities, web scraping, infinite scrolling, detailed single pages, an admin area, a comment section, CRUD (Create, Read, Update, Delete) operations, and much more!
Key Features & Technologies:
- Full Stack JavaScript - You'll be using JavaScript across the entire application stack.
- MongoDB - Leverage its JSON-like documentation for a smoother database interaction.
- MEAN Stack Components - From setting up your Node.js backend to creating dynamic frontend with AngularJS, you'll touch on every aspect of the MEAN stack.
- RESTful API Development - Learn how to create and manage RESTful services.
- Web Scraping - Utilize the
Request
andCheerio
modules to scrape websites effectively. - Infinite Scrolling - Implement a Pinterest-like feature to enhance user engagement.
- Image Uploading - Learn how to upload, save, and manage images within your application.
- AngularJS Animation - Explore
ngAnimate
for smooth transitions. - Responsive Design - Style your app using Bootstrap for a mobile-friendly experience.
- MongoDB Schemas - Design and utilize up to three different MongoDB schemas with the help of
Mongoose
.
What You Will Learn:
✅ Understanding the architecture required to build a full stack web application.
✅ Creating and using RESTful APIs in your web applications.
✅ Techniques for web scraping with Node.js modules.
✅ Crafting a Pinterest-style view that supports infinite scrolling.
✅ Uploading, storing, and managing images efficiently.
✅ Implementing view transitions using ngAnimate
.
✅ Styling your application with Bootstrap for a responsive user interface.
✅ Designing and implementing MongoDB schemas using Mongoose.
Join Patrick Schroeder in this comprehensive course to build your own "Best Dressed" MEAN stack application, enhancing your full stack JavaScript skills and adding a powerful tool to your developer belt! 🌟
Note: This course assumes you are familiar with Node.js and AngularJS 1.x. If you're not, consider taking introductory courses on each before jumping in. Happy coding! 🧑💻✨
Course Gallery




Loading charts...